### Australia to Face India in Second ODI Clash at Adelaide Oval
On Thursday, October 23, Australia will take on India in the second ODI of the three-match series at the iconic Adelaide Oval. The picturesque venue, located on the South Australian coast, is set to witness an intense battle as both teams look to secure a victory.
**Australia’s Dominant Performance in Previous Match**
In the previous contest in Perth, Australia, led by Mitchell Marsh, displayed a dominant performance as they comfortably chased down the 132-run target set by India. The Australian side looked in terrific form as they clinched the victory by a seven-wicket margin using the DLS method.

**Adelaide Oval Pitch Report**
The Adelaide Oval pitch provides an evenly-balanced surface for an exciting battle between bat and ball. Over the years, the pitch has offered bounce and carry, favoring fast bowlers. However, batsmen can also capitalize on the good bounce and faster outfields to score runs. A total over 300 runs can be considered competitive and a winning score on this venue.
